... Read moreWhen planning a budget-friendly trip from Richmond, VA (RVA) to Washington, DC, you have several options that maximize convenience and minimize costs. One of the most popular choices is taking the Mega Bus, which offers fares as low as $26 one way. This travel service has a direct route, taking just about 2 hours, making it an efficient alternative to driving. Moreover, for those who prefer a different experience, Capital Area Transit provides commuter services that can be a reliable option for daily travels. Additionally, travelers can also consider using other bus services like Greyhound or Coach USA, which cater to passengers traveling between major cities. It's essential to book in advance to secure the best prices and ensure availability during peak travel times. Many travelers also find using public transportation within DC to enhance their visit, as the Metro system connects you to key sites around the city, including popular attractions like the National Mall, museums, and historic monuments. Travel tips such as optimizing your itinerary, traveling outside of peak hours, and utilizing discount passes can further enhance your cost-effective travel experience.
